Otto those certain pieces or parcels of land, with the buildings and improvements
thereon erected, situate, lying and being east of Greenport; in the Town of Southold,
County of Suffolk and State of New York, bounded and described as follows:
PARCELI:
BEGINNING at a monument set in the easterly line of Inlet Lane distant 450 feet
southerly measured along the easterly line o`. 1+1,n Jane, from southerly line of
Manhanset Avenue; running thence South 87 Degrees 05 minutes 00 seconds East
along the southerly line of land now or formerly of John J. Morris 280 feet, more
or less, to the shore of Gull Pond Inlet; thence southerly along the said Inlet to the
northerly line of land now or formerly of Jacob W. Tyler and Wilhelmina Tyler,
his wife, at a point distant 100 feet southerly from the southerly line of land now or
formerly of John J. Morris, when measured at right angles hereto; thence North
87 degrees 05 minutes 00 seconds West along the said land now or formerly of Jacob
W. Tyler and Wilhelmina Tyler, his wife, 220 feet, more or less to the easterly
line of Inlet Lane; thence North 12 degrees 29 minutes 20 seconds East along the
easterly line of Inlet Lane, 46.45 feet to a monument; and thence North 2 degrees
55 minutes 00 seconds East still along the easterly line of Inlet Lane 54.20 feet to
the point or place of beginning.

TOGETHER with a right ofway over north adjoining property to that portion of
Manhanset Avenue or the easterly continuation thereof lying between the waters of
Gull Pond Inlet and Gardiners or Marion Bay.
TOGETHER with all the right, titleatd interest of the parties of the first part of,
in and to the lands lying under the waters of Gull Pont Inlet and Gardiners or Marion
Bay adjacent to said premises.
SUBJECT to easements or rights of way over and along Parcel II herein infavor
of owners of properties lying to the north and south thereof.
BEING AND INTENDED TO BE the same premises conveyed to Guy Severac and
Madeleine Severac, his wife, by Patricia Tennant and Barbara A. Leary by deed
dated November 21st, 1961 and recorded in the Suffolk County Clerk's office on
j November 27th, 1961 in Liber 5087 of deeds at page 57.
The conveyance hereunder is subject to a certain mortgage executed by Guy Severac
and Madeleine Severac, his wife, as mortgagors to Riverhead Savings Bank, as
mortgagee, which mortgage is dated November 21th, 1961 and on which mortgage
there is now due the sum of$14,291.75 with interest thereon at the rate of 6% per
annum and the grantee hereby covenants to pay such mortgage debt and interest
as part of the consideration for this conveyance.
